Talked to Comptech regarding the titanium strut bar.

Hey guys,

This is just a FYI.

I talked to Comptech regarding their titanium strut bar for the 2nd gen TL.

They said they no longer make the titanium strut nor plan to put it back in their lineup anytime soon. They also said they may make aluminum bars sometime in the future. Only time will tell.
